3rd down efficiency is all too often dependent on 1st down efficiency. If you can reliably pick up 4 yds (on avg) on 1st down, 2d and 3rd down start getting a lot easier and have a larger playlist of calls.

Get a lot of 1-2 yd results on 1st down, you get more 2d and 3rd and long situations. Degree of difficulty rises quickly.

I don't believe you value anything over TDs, with the possible exception of ball control on a short lead with the clock winding down. But how you get those TDs sure gets easier with a solid advance on 1st down. We were not good at that last year. We ran for 1 or 2, while our opposition ran for 5 or 6 when they had the ball. That was a real tell in how our game was going to play out. When your success DEPENDS on hitting the long ball you are very likely to fail more often than you win. That we pulled out 12 wins last season seems miraculous to me.
